📖 What Does Samiyah Mean?

Samiyah is an Arabic name that signifies a high status or rank. It is derived from the root word 'sama', meaning 'to elevate' or 'to raise'.

🕊️ Cultural & Spiritual Significance

Cultural Impact

In the Arab and Islamic culture, the name Samiyah carries an esteemed meaning due to its connection with elevated status and prestige. It can be seen as a desirable name for those aspiring to achieve great things or for parents who wish to grant their child a name that evokes feelings of admiration and respect.

Spiritual Significance

From a spiritual perspective, the name Samiyah can be interpreted as a reminder of one's connection to the divine and the journey towards spiritual elevation. It is also believed that the name holds a special significance for those on the path of mutual love, friendship, and understanding, as it is derived from the same root as 'as-Sami', the name of Allah meaning "The All-Hearing". This suggests that just as Allah is ever-listening and attentive to our calls, those who bear the name Samiyah are encouraged to embody this quality of attentiveness and compassion towards others.
